In the event that returning farmers and residents discover spilled pesticides, fuel or other chemicals, please contact DHEC’s spill response team: South Carolina Chemical Spill Response.
During clean-up after storms, spilled chemicals and pesticides may pose a threat to some residents, please contact South Carolina poison control center: Palmetto Poison Control Hotline.
